  • Patent number: 10363834
    Abstract: In accordance with an aspect of the present disclosure, a vehicle has an electric traction motor and a high voltage module having a low voltage section and a high voltage section. The low voltage section includes a power over fiber receive module and a first optical data module. A low voltage supply is electrically connected to a power over fiber transmit module. The power over fiber transmit module is optically coupled by a power over fiber cable to the power over fiber receive module of the low voltage section of the high voltage module. An electronic motor control unit includes a second optical data module that is optically coupled by an optical fiber data bus cable to the first optical data module of the low voltage section of the high voltage module.

  • Publication number: 20170334295
    Abstract: A high voltage isolation tester has a high voltage side and a low voltage side coupled to each other by isolation amplifiers so that the high and low voltage sides are electrically isolated from each other. The high voltage side includes positive and negative high voltage test inputs and a common test input. The high voltage side also includes a positive switched voltage divider network and a negative switched voltage divider network. The low voltage side includes a controller that automatically controls switching of the switched voltage divider networks to make voltage measurements of voltages at inputs of the isolation amplifiers. Outputs of the isolation amplifiers are coupled to inputs of an analog-to-digital converter and the digitized voltages are read from the analog-to-digital converter by the controller.

  • Patent number: 7750821
    Abstract: A message center that can comprise a liquid crystal display (LCD) is provided. The LCD can be divided into one or more zones, with each zone being designated for a specific message. The message center can also include a light guide system positioned behind the liquid crystal display. The light guide system can have one or more light guides, with each of the light guides having a first end, and each of the light guides can be aligned with a zone of the liquid crystal display. The message center can further include a multi-color light emitting diode (LED) that can be mounted at the first end of each of the light guides, and a control system that can set the intensity of each of the multi-colors on each of the LEDs such that a backlighting of each zone is individually controlled.

  • Patent number: 7374323
    Abstract: The various embodiments of the present invention generally include a display device having a surface with indicia formed thereon. The indicia are indicative of at least one vehicle parameter. The display device includes a light guide connected to the surface and a light-reflecting portion formed in the light guide. The light-reflecting portion is disposed at least partially over one of the indicia. The light guide collects light, directs the light toward the light-reflecting portion and illuminates at least one of the indicia. The light guide and the light reflecting portion provide an enhanced or decorative effect for one or more of the indicia.

  • Publication number: 20060215589
    Abstract: A vehicle communication system includes a vehicle cluster having a CPU. The CPU includes a transceiver that is adapted to directly communicate with a remote terminal via a GSM protocol to send and receive video and audio data. A display monitor is coupled to the CPU and receives an output video data signal from the CPU. The display monitor generates a video image that is based on incoming video data transmitted from the remote terminal to the transceiver. A camera is coupled to the CPU and transmits an input video data signal. A speaker is coupled to the CPU and receives an output audio signal. A microphone is coupled to the CPU and transmits an input audio signal to the CPU. The CPU sends an outgoing audio and video signal to the remote terminal in response to receipt of the input audio and video signal.

  • Patent number: 6542133
    Abstract: A lighted display for a vehicle instrument panel in which a single light source is used to display a plurality of messages indicating various vehicle operating conditions. A plurality of light-using message plates is mounted adjacent the light source, each message plate being independently activated by an electrical muscle wire to move the associated message plate into the lighted region of the display. When vehicle operating parameters are such that the message is no longer needed, current to the muscle wire is shut off and the message plate is returned to its unilluminated rest position by a return spring.

  • Patent number: 6441746
    Abstract: An actuating mechanism for a relative slow-acting vehicle gauge indicator, such as a rotatable pointer. A muscle wire driven rack gear is operatively connected to a rotatable pointer gear. The rack gear is biased to a gauge at-rest position by a spring member. Upon receiving an electrical signal from a vehicle sensor, the muscle wire contracts, moving the rack member against the spring force to drive the gauge pointer to an appropriate reading on a gauge face.
